Our first day of student attendance will be Wednesday, August 24th. We will be in school full-time each day. Our school day runs from 8:00AM until 2:30PM. They will enter through the main entrance (if they are a car rider or walker), or Door 3 (if they ride the school bus to school). They will make their way right to their classroom. We will have plenty of extra staff members around the first couple weeks of school to help our little Bobcats to their classroom, if they need support. Parents are not allowed inside the building to assist their student. At dismissal time, bus riders will be escorted by a staff member to the bus daily for the entire year. Walkers and car riders will be dismissed out of Door 9, which can be accessed via the playground around the back of the school.
Breakfast and lunch are served at school daily, free of charge to every student! You can find a menu for the month of August below. Please note that although students can bring in a "cold lunch" from home, there is not option for students to bring in their own breakfast. They can either eat breakfast before they leave for school, or eat with their classmates in their classroom as they start their day.
